cdaddy7I would not take it bc you will have enough water weight gain from the gear..It does kinda puts stress on the kidneys but I just wouldn't add it to the mix on cycle...Creatine is a cell volumizer and it could be beneficial in PCT in giving you and edge on the side of ATP utilization which will help with your endurance deficit from coming off...They used to say it increased homocysteine levels but the newer studies show that it really doesn't have any effect on them...You got enough going on in your body with gear alone I wouldn't add another stressor if didnt have to

yea creatine works different than AAS. But ASS has the same effect of increasing water retention and adds the benefit of greater nitrogen uptake.. creatine's actual affect is to convert ADP in ATP in the muscle meaning it gives your muscles a little more reserve energy. When off cycle and the body is crashing and RBC count is decreasing back, and working out may seem exhausting is when in my opinion you'll appreciate the little extra boost and pump. If you rip creatine all the time you won't notice it post cycle at all.
Also, and I may be wrong here, but on cycle with the body functioning so well for growth and strength and the added calories I would almost be certain your creatine intake from food would match/if not exceed the body's natural limit so taking extra would literally be pissing it away. Most especially if your eating beef and fish.
